5. Calculate the resistive and inductive component R and L using the formulas shown in Table
6-8. (Alternatively, use the 16 bit CIGUI.)
6. Enter these values, in the OUTPUT CAL screen for the IMP. REAL MIN and IMP. REACT
MIN value respectively. Make sure the correct phase is selected or use the PHASE key if
not.
7. Remove or turn off the load.
8. From the MENU 3 screen, select OUTPUT IMPEDANCE. Press the PHASE key to select
the phase to be calibrated. Program the output inductance to 796 uH and the resistance to
400 mOhms.
9. Select the Calibration, Output screen and move the cursor to the IMP REAL FS field.
Measure the R and L by removing and applying the load as described before and calculating
the R and L using the formula's in Table 6-7.
Adjust the resistive output impedance using the shuttle until the measured output is as close
as possible to 400 mOhm. Make sure the correct phase is selected or use the PHASE key if
not. Do the same with the IMP REACT FS field. Note that the adjustment range for R is 0 to
100, for L is 0 to 300.
10. If there is not enough range in the full-scale calibration coefficient for either resistive or
inductive portion, it may be necessary to tweak the adjustment pots on the iX controller.
These pots were originally adjusted at the factory and normally do not have to be adjusted
again. The Full Scale calibration coefficients should have enough adjustment range. Double
check the connections and phase measurements if this is not the case to make sure the
measurement readings you get are indeed correct.
If it is necessary to adjust the pots, see Table 6-7 for the corresponding pot designators. The
top cover has to be removed to access these pots. They are located along the top edge of
the controller board(s). Adjustments for phase A are on the phase A/CPU board (5100-707),
adjustments for phase B and C are on the phase B/C board (7000-722).
11. Repeat steps 2 through 10 for phase B and C.
